Rice Water Benefits: What Nutrition Science Says About This Ancient Wellness Drink
Rice water — the starchy liquid left behind after soaking or boiling rice — has been used across Asian cultures for centuries as both a food and a topical remedy. Today it's gained renewed attention as a wellness drink, often grouped with other infused waters for its mild nutritional profile and reported digestive effects. Here's what nutrition science generally shows about it, and what shapes how different people respond.
What Rice Water Actually Is
Soaked rice water is made by steeping uncooked rice in water for anywhere from 30 minutes to several hours, then straining off the liquid. Boiled rice water is the liquid drained after cooking rice, which tends to be more concentrated. Fermented rice water — left to sit for 12–24 hours — has a longer history in skincare traditions and may have a slightly different nutrient profile due to microbial activity.
None of these are nutritionally dense drinks in the way whole grains or fortified beverages are. But they do contain small amounts of compounds that have drawn scientific interest.
What Rice Water Generally Contains
The nutritional content of rice water is modest and varies depending on the rice variety, water ratio, preparation method, and soaking or cooking time. Research has identified the following components:
| Component | What It Is | Notes |
|---|---|---|
| Starch (inositol) | A carbohydrate-related compound | May play a role in cell signaling; present in small amounts |
| B vitamins | Including thiamine (B1), niacin (B3) | More present in water from white rice; modest levels |
| Minerals | Trace amounts of potassium, magnesium | Levels are low compared to whole rice |
| Ferulic acid | A plant-based antioxidant | Present in rice bran; may leach into water in small quantities |
| GABA (gamma-aminobutyric acid) | An amino acid compound | More associated with germinated rice; research is early-stage |
The concentrations of these compounds in rice water are generally low. Rice water is not a substitute for the nutrients found in whole grains themselves.
Digestive Effects: What the Research Suggests
The most consistently documented use of rice water is in managing acute diarrhea, particularly in children. Studies — including those published in the context of oral rehydration research — have found that rice-based oral rehydration solutions may help reduce stool output and support fluid absorption compared to plain water or standard glucose-based solutions. The mechanism is thought to involve the starch content, which provides glucose gradually through digestion and may support sodium-glucose cotransport in the gut.
The World Health Organization has historically acknowledged rice-based oral rehydration fluids in its research literature, though standard ORS formulations remain the clinical reference point. 🔬
It's worth noting that most of this research focuses on rice-based oral rehydration solutions formulated at specific concentrations — not the informal home preparation of rice water. The nutritional composition of homemade rice water is much harder to standardize.
For general digestive comfort — bloating, irritable digestion, or mild stomach upset — rice water is widely used in traditional medicine systems, but clinical evidence in healthy adults is limited. Most reports are anecdotal or based on small observational studies.
Skin and Hair: A Different Conversation
Rice water's popular association with skin brightness and hair strength largely comes from topical use, not oral consumption. Fermented rice water applied to hair is a centuries-old practice in parts of Japan and China. Some small studies have looked at inositol and ferulic acid in skincare contexts, showing modest antioxidant and barrier-support effects in laboratory and limited human studies — but these findings apply to topical formulations, not drinking rice water.
Oral consumption of rice water has not been shown in strong clinical research to produce the same skin or hair effects often claimed in wellness content. The gap between topical application research and claims about drinking rice water is significant.
Electrolyte and Hydration Considerations
Rice water contains trace electrolytes, which has led some to describe it as a mild natural rehydration drink. Compared to plain water, it does provide small amounts of potassium and sodium (the latter especially when salt is added during cooking). However, its electrolyte concentrations are far below those of clinical rehydration solutions and should not be treated as equivalent in situations of significant fluid or electrolyte loss.
For everyday hydration in healthy people, rice water presents no known harm, but it also provides no established hydration advantage over plain water unless prepared with added minerals or salt.
Variables That Shape Individual Responses
How — or whether — rice water affects any individual depends on a range of factors:
- Blood sugar regulation: Rice water contains digestible starch that raises blood glucose. People monitoring carbohydrate intake or managing insulin response should factor this in.
- Digestive conditions: Those with certain gut disorders, food sensitivities, or conditions affecting carbohydrate absorption may respond differently than healthy adults.
- Diet overall: Someone already eating a varied, nutrient-dense diet gains little nutritionally from rice water. For someone with limited dietary variety, even modest B vitamin or mineral content becomes more relevant.
- Rice variety: Brown rice water retains more of the bran layer, potentially offering slightly more fiber-associated compounds. White rice water has a more neutral profile.
- Preparation method: Soaked, boiled, and fermented rice water differ in pH, microbial activity, and nutrient content. Fermented versions are not well-studied as oral preparations.
- Arsenic considerations: Rice can absorb inorganic arsenic from soil and water. Most food safety guidance focuses on whole rice consumption, but this factor has been noted in discussions about frequent rice water intake, particularly in populations that rely heavily on rice as a dietary staple. 🌾
What the Evidence Does and Doesn't Support
Research on rice water as a wellness drink is still relatively thin. The strongest evidence exists for rice-based rehydration in acute diarrhea management — and even that applies to specific formulations rather than casual home preparation. Evidence for broader claims around skin health, detoxification, weight management, or immune support is either early-stage, anecdotal, or extrapolated from unrelated research on rice compounds.
Whether rice water fits into a useful part of someone's diet depends on what that person's overall eating pattern looks like, their specific health circumstances, and what they're hoping to address — none of which can be answered in general terms.
